Lil Uzi Vert fan rips off $24M pink forehead diamond, Internet calls it 'inevitable'
The gigantic pink diamond was planted on rapper’s forehead in February which he bought from his favorite jewelry designer Elliot Eliantte
Lil Uzi Vert, who raised quite a few eyebrows with his $24million pink forehead diamond, is no longer rocking the same look and the mystery behind the same was recently uncovered by the rapper himself. spilled the beans that his nearly 11-carat rare diamond got ripped out after he stage-dived into the audience during the Rolling Loud Miami festival in July.
video shared by the publication TMZ quickly broke the Internet after the rapper can be seen revealing the truth behind him not seen with his expensive body mod. The gigantic pink diamond was planted on forehead in February which he bought from his favorite jewelry designer Elliot Eliantte. Lil Uzi then quickly became the butt of jokes back in February and the tradition followed with his latest confession as well. memes getting compared to Marvel’s Vision earlier broke the Internet leaving social media users in splits.

Why Lil Uzi Vert is not spotted with his $24M pink forehead diamond anymore?
The Philadelphia native in the video revealed that fans ripped out his diamond after he jumped into the crowd at the music festival. However, luckily no one stole it as the rapper added that he was elated with the fact that he still had the diamond. Lil Uzi Vert, whose real name is Symere Bysil Woods, told the publication at the 18th anniversary of Jay-Z’s 40/40 club last month, “I had a show at Rolling Loud and I jumped into the crowd and they kind of ripped it out.” Vert added, “I’m feeling good. I still have the diamond so I feel good.”
The hip-hop artist was regularly seen with his new look until June when he ditched the pink diamond during public appearances. Speaking on the same, he had earlier revealed that the diamond caused him bleeding to which his jeweler had then shared that the implant was safe like any other piercing. The rapper had then again donned the diamond for the Rolling Loud Miami edition in July. Uzi Vert had also shed details earlier on how he managed to cop this rare pink diamond saying he was paying the money for it since 2017. He had also confessed that this diamond was the most expensive thing he had ever owned. Speaking of bizarre purchases, Lil Uzi Vert recently made headlines for showing interest in buying a planet. However, nothing has been materialized so far.
